It is 1 of 140 ish. I decoded the Dealer order logs from ASC and I got 140 GTA's or Trans Am's with the 350 and 42 Formula 350's. Unfortunately the logs had 324 Cars total, and I could only decipher 309 as 10 cars were exported and another 5 have no Carfax/Autocheck records, so I could not trace those. I even tried Europe's carfax with no luck...
On a side note I actually have a letter from ASC that "Claimed" to have only made 10 Formula 350's and I suspect there is another letter that states a total of 50 L98 vert's total in 1989... I have no clue where they pulled those numbers from... The total number is closer to just under 200 TOTAL 350 cars made into a Vert, as there was at least 4 IROC's in 1987, but possibly no more as NONE have ever showed up to be verified.
The condition is hard to say, I did notice that it appears to have the SLP Cat-Back system on it, or one that is similar as the tips are identical to my 87 with the SLP cat-back. I noticed some stains ons the passenger seat, and I do know at least some of it was repainted as when I first saw the car the front fender was damaged. (That is when he was asking $3900)
Honestly if you want something rare then yeah, its a blast to own... Just over 600 Firebird Verts were made between 1987 & 1989, no 1990's. They were converted by ASC, and all the parts are the same as a camaro except for the obvious cosmetic changes, so parts are really not an issue, which can be an issue for the special order cars like Matrix3, Hi-Line and Autoform.
The only hard to find parts would be the rear quarter Caps or spears (depending on what you call them) and the 3rd brake light housing, which may have been used on something else. I do know that the wing was a Base wing that the ends were cut off of and filled with bondo & Painted. All other parts are basically 1989 Camaro parts, Top, interior trim, SFC's etc...
I have no clue what to value it at. Definitely worth $8K IMHO. $10K may be stretching it BUT as far as collectibility I think there is a future market as the 350 cars were NA in the Factory Verts, and Power sells...
I would like a better pic of the Drivers & passenger seat, and a better pic of the bottom of the doors where they rust is typically in the middle where the rubber window bumper stopper hits the bottom of the door. AND I would like a better pic of the Engine.
I would also like to see a pic of the top side of the trunk. The paint ASC used did not hold up as well as the original GM and I noticed the photographer neglected to get any pics of the top of the trunk. Also it may be missing a black trim piece around the base of the 3rd brake light. My car is missing it as well as I have only seen a few cars with it still intact.
